Biography
American jockey from 1976 who recorded an astonishing 1,704 wins. The son of a blacksmith and a trainer-mom, he was riding at full gallop from age five. Cauthen was a pro rider at 16, the "boy wonder" who once won 23 of 54 races in a week. At 17, he won a record $6.1 million in purses and in his first two years won more than 900 races, including the Triple Crown in the spring of 1978. He rode two winners on New Years Day, 1979, and suddenly had a losing streak of 100 races until it broke on 2/01/1979.
At the end of 1985, Cauthen took a three-week alcohol rehab break as he was afraid he was getting too fond of his drink. In 1988, he broke his neck in a bad spill and was laid up for seven months.
After Cauthen married in 1991, he and Amy bought 300 acres of prime Kentucky horse country; their first child was born in July 1993. He took a job as a race announcer on 5/01/1993.
